Fleet Maintenance Facilities & Electrification

Case studies1 conducted by transportation authorities throughout the US have found that maintenance facility requirements are generally similar for fully-electrified bus fleets compared to conventional transit vehicles. Agencies are ideally looking for battery electric buses (BEB) that can match the operating range and performance of traditional transit buses, since this would result in minimal impact to operations. While tooling and techniques may be different, facility envelopes and major equipment are likely to be compatible between technologies. Charging and electrical power infrastructure are recognized as a key focal point as large-scale deployments are considered.
